When we lived in a really small flat we only had one really small bathroom. It was hard, especially in the mornings when my husband wanted to shower and shave but I had to do my hair and make up. Our solution was that we moved everything that did not need water out of the bathroom: hairbrush, hairdryer, make up, deodorant etc. We put these things in a dresser in the hall and used them there. There was a big mirror above the dresser so it was like a vanity. And it worked! Maybe you could find a similar solution?

I think it is funny that I have been with you since the Malitose79 days and I never get tired of watching you. 2 things you taught me that have really changed my life and that have helped me keep my home tidy; are to store things where you use them which also makes it extremely easy to put things away. The second thing that really helps me is to put things away where I would look for the item first if the item were lost. Before you helped me realize I was a ladybug, I thought I was a hot mess but what you taught me was that if I am constantly losing things (which I was) because of homeless clutter, move it to where you would have looked for it. If something needs to be relocated to make room for something else, just do it as long as it is near where you use the item most often. I never lose anything now because everything has a designated place. FYI, (for me at least) I have discovered that if I take the time to make a label for the item, I am much more likely to remember where it is located.

One thing that has helped me save space for decor is to use pillow covers. I put the pillow covers on in the opposite order of how I will use them. For example my Christmas covers just came off but underneath is my normal winter pillow cover, underneath that one is spring, then summer, then fall. When Christmas comes around again I start the process over and put the Fall cover, then summer, then spring, winter and finish with Christmas cover. As you remove them it goes from season to season with minimal effort. I even store the used covers folded and place on the inside back of the zippered pillow covers. Hope that makes sense because now it is so easy to keep my pillows and not have to take up a bunch of space to store them.
